Birth rate by women's age group in Zambia
Zambia: Birth rate by women's age group was 115.91 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 in 2023. ▼ Falling
Birth rate by women's age group in Zambia, 1950–2023
Source: UN, World Population Prospects (2024) – processed by Our World in Data. Measured in live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19.
Analysis
In 2023, birth rate by women's age group in Zambia stood at 115.91 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19. That is the lowest value across all 74 years on record.
That represents a change of down 1.3% on the previous year and down 10.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, birth rate by women's age group in Zambia peaked at 197.7 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 in 1975 and was at its lowest, 115.91 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19, in 2023.
Zambia ranks 12th of 236 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 74 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 173.15 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 170.39 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 177.53 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 1960s | 182.88 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 179.23 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 185.14 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 1970s | 191.44 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 179.83 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 197.7 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 1980s | 161.91 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 154.54 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 169.6 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 1990s | 152.34 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 149.17 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 156.3 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 2000s | 142.87 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 133.4 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 155.69 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 2010s | 128.13 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 122.9 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 131.37 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 10 |
| 2020s | 118.19 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 115.91 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 120.71 live births per 1,000 women aged 15-19 | 4 |
